It is reported that Mamelodi Sundowns player Gift Motupa and his uncle were involved in a car accident on R37 road Burgersford.
The two are said to have escaped with minor injuries.
Motupa joined Sundowns from the now defunct Bidvest Wits in the off-season, alongside Haashim Domingo and Ricardo Goss, but has yet to feature for the club due to injury.
His expected debut will now be pushed further back after he escaped with minor injuries when his car veered off the road earlier today, before being written off.
It is believed the South Africa international lost control of his white Golf 7 GTi and rolled off the R37 as he was en route home to Polokwane, and received medical attention on the scene.
The 26-year-old was understood to have been traveling alone at the time as the Masandawan squad were given time off ahead of the intentional break.
